The base fabric is a high-quality cloth called Glasgow, composed of 93% polyester, 5% viscose, and 2% elastane, with a weight of 380 gr/m2 and a width of 150 cm. Its printed design stands out for its standard complexity, inspired by botanical and artistic nature, with a home decor focus. The floral design incorporates artistic and pictorial flowers in grape purple, cotton white, and midnight black tones, with drawn patterns. This fabric combines perfectly with solid colors such as black, red, or mustard. The fabric is printed with the design on one side using digital textile printing.
Glasgow has a soft texture, making it a comfortable fabric to wear that adapts perfectly to the skin. The printed design adds an artistic and elegant touch to the garment or accessory made. The applications of this fabric are diverse, covering both feminine and masculine fashion, including garments such as coats, jackets, or blazers, as well as accessories like coasters. In addition, this fabric is especially suitable for altars and home decor.
It is important to highlight the care that should be taken when working with this fabric. It should not be bleached, dry cleaning is not allowed, it should be ironed at a warm temperature, and it cannot be tumble dried. The recommendation is to hand wash gently or machine wash at a maximum temperature of 40ºC.
The printing technology used to manufacture this fabric is sublimation on polyester. This technique allows vibrant and detailed images to be printed that will not fade or lose quality over time. Each color of the design is printed separately and fused with the polyester fiber using heat and pressure, achieving high-quality reproduction of the design.
